The Evolution of Online Gaming Platforms

Online gaming platforms have undergone a remarkable transformation over the past few decades. Initially, these platforms were limited by technological constraints, offering simple, often text-based games. However, with the advent of broadband internet and more powerful computing capabilities, online gaming evolved into a visually rich and interactive experience. This evolution saw the rise of massively multiplayer online role-playing games (MMORPGs) and competitive esports, attracting millions of players worldwide. Today’s platforms often incorporate social features, allowing players to connect with friends, form communities, and participate in collaborative gaming experiences. The user experience has become paramount, with developers focusing on intuitive interfaces, seamless gameplay, and personalized recommendations. This is a significant shift from the early days of online gaming, which often required technical expertise and a willingness to endure frustrating glitches.

The Role of User-Generated Content

A key driver of growth for many online gaming platforms is the integration of user-generated content. Platforms that allow players to create and share their own games, levels, or mods foster a vibrant and engaged community. This not only expands the content library but also provides a sense of ownership and creativity among players. User-generated content can range from simple modifications to existing games to entirely new creations, pushing the boundaries of what’s possible within the platform. This collaborative approach can lead to unexpected innovations and a more diverse range of gaming experiences. Furthermore, it reduces the reliance on developers to constantly create new content, making the platform more sustainable and adaptable to changing player preferences.

The impact of this approach is particularly notable within the independent gaming scene, where smaller developers and individual creators can reach a wider audience through platforms that showcase user-generated content. This democratizes the game development process, allowing fresh voices and innovative ideas to emerge.

The Importance of Community and Social Interaction

A thriving community is often the lifeblood of a successful online entertainment platform. Players are more likely to return to a platform where they feel connected to others, can share their experiences, and participate in meaningful interactions. Platforms that prioritize community building often incorporate features such as chat rooms, forums, social media integration, and in-game events. These features provide opportunities for players to connect with like-minded individuals, form friendships, and collaborate on shared goals. A strong community can also act as a valuable source of feedback for developers, helping them to improve the platform and create new content that resonates with players.

Moderation and Safety in Online Communities

However, maintaining a healthy and safe online community requires careful moderation and a commitment to protecting players from harassment, abuse, and other harmful behaviors. Platforms must implement robust moderation systems, enforce clear community guidelines, and provide users with the tools to report inappropriate content. This is particularly important for platforms that cater to younger audiences, as they are more vulnerable to online predators and cyberbullying. Effective moderation requires a combination of automated tools and human oversight, ensuring that the community remains a welcoming and inclusive space for all.
